This specimen was lot 3328 in Steve Album Auction 51 (Santa Rosa, CA, January 2025), where it sold for $114. The catalog description[1] noted, "SPITZBERGEN (SVALBARD): 20 kopecks, 1946, Arktikugol token, light cleaning, XF, ex Hans Mondorf Collection. The Soviet (later Russian) state-owned Arktikugol company has mined coal on the Island of Spitsbergen in the Svalbard Archipelago since 1932." This token was issued for use in the Russian concession on Spitzbergen (also known in Norwegian as Svalbard). Ten, fifteen and fifty kopek tokens were also issued in 1946. It was struck in Leningrad.

Recorded mintage: 25,000.

Specifications: 3 g, copper-nickel, 20 mm diameter, reeded edge.

Catalog reference: KM-Tn3.
